puglia

My husband visited puglia in May....all is well, the people are delightful and friendly. There is no problem about being "bothered" unless you are a local.
The fields are full of wild flowers such as have not been seen in the UK for a couple of centuries.
Usually by the bins there is rubbish everywhere and on the coast, most people aim it at the bins rather than putting it in.
The coastal motorway has potholes in it. ha, but still beautiful scenery, baroque towns.
Naples always a place of dark doings, but worth a visit, and Pompeii, never to be forgotten.
The Dark Heart of Italy by Tobias Jones a good read about the mindset, tax evasion, football, general attitudes!
